Microclimates are localized areas with distinct climate characteristics compared to their surrounding environment. They can serve an essential role in gardening, offering benefits that can transform your outdoor space into a thriving ecosystem. For instance:

  • Frost protection: Certain pockets of your garden can be protected from frost, particularly in the shadow of walls or large trees. This protective effect can extend the growing season, allowing you to cultivate crops like tomatoes and peppers that are sensitive to cold.
  • Humidity control: Designated areas can retain moisture better, especially if integrated with a rain garden or specific plant choices that naturally conserve water. This aspect is particularly useful during dry spells, increasing your garden’s overall drought resistance.
  • Wind barriers: Using natural structures such as hedges or fences can minimize wind exposure, drastically reducing stress on delicate plants. Windbreaks can also create warmer air pockets that foster an inviting environment for more sensitive flora.

Creating a microclimate requires thoughtful planning and a bit of creativity. Here are several factors that influence microclimates and ideas on how to incorporate them effectively:

  • Topography: The hills and slopes in your yard can dramatically affect sunlight and air movement. For example, positioning your garden on a southern slope can offer ample sunlight, while a north-facing slope may be cooler and shadier, suitable for plants that thrive in lower temperatures.
  • Vegetation: The strategic placement of trees, shrubs, and even large pots can provide much-needed shade or shelter. Deciduous trees planted to the west can block the harsh afternoon sun in summer but allow sunlight through during winter when they lose their leaves.
  • Materials: Utilizing materials such as stones or walls can absorb heat throughout the day and release it at night. This concept is prevalent in rock gardens and also extends to incorporating concrete pathways that capture and radiate warmth, beneficial for plant roots.

To successfully manipulate microclimates, consider several vital components that can enhance your gardening strategy:

  • Sun Exposure: Sunlight is an essential factor in plant vitality. Different plants have distinct light requirements, and microclimates can help fulfill these varying needs. For instance, positioning taller plants, such as sunflowers or corn, on the southern edge of your garden can create partial shade for shade-loving species such as ferns or hostas. This layering not only protects delicate plants from the intense midday sun but also creates visual interest by adding depth to your garden design.
  • Water Availability: Efficient water management is integral to thriving gardens, especially in regions prone to drought. Introduce zones for water retention through features like rain gardens, which can capture and filter runoff, or install a drip irrigation system for precise watering. Organic mulch, such as wood chips or straw, serves a dual purpose: it retains moisture in the soil while suppressing weeds, ultimately enhancing plant health during dry spells.
  • Soil Composition: Diverse soils behave differently regarding moisture retention and nutrient availability. Conduct soil testing to understand its pH and nutrient profile so you can improve it effectively. Incorporating organic matter, like compost or aged manure, enriches soil quality, fostering a thriving ecosystem that supports healthy plant growth. This enrichment also enhances the microclimate by stimulating beneficial microbial activity in the soil.

Furthermore, the incorporation of raised garden beds can be a game-changer in your gardening strategy. These elevated beds warm up faster in the spring, providing suitable conditions for early planting. Their design allows for improved drainage, reducing the risk of root rot and creating a healthier root environment. Placing these beds close to walls or fences can amplify heat-trapping benefits, creating a slightly warmer atmosphere for your plants—especially useful for heat-loving varieties like tomatoes and peppers.

Identify Your Garden’s Unique Features

Start by analyzing the topography, soil type, and existing vegetation in your garden. Elevated areas tend to be more exposed to wind, while valleys may trap cold air. Such variations allow you to pinpoint spots where specific plants will thrive better. If your garden has dense trees or structures, these can provide valuable shade that protects tender plants from harsh sunlight or frost.

Utilize Plants to Create Microclimates

One effective method for establishing microclimates is through the strategic positioning of plants. Consider grouping taller plants or shrubs to act as a windbreak for more delicate flora. This not only offers protection but will also create a moderated atmosphere, retaining moisture in warmer months. Companion planting can also enhance the growth of particular species by replenishing soil nutrients or providing relief from pests.

Water Features and Their Benefits

Incorporating water features such as ponds or fountains can be a game changer for your garden’s microclimate. The presence of water not only supports biodiversity but also impacts the garden’s humidity levels. Surrounding plants can benefit from the increased moisture, reducing the stress on them during hot periods. Furthermore, water bodies can reflect sunlight and help in cooling the surrounding areas, creating a more balanced environment.

Implementing Weather-Resistant Structures

Lastly, consider implementing structures like greenhouses or cold frames to extend your growing season. These constructions can trap heat during colder months, providing a more stable environment for plants that may struggle in variable conditions. Additionally, using row covers can protect seedlings from late frosts or excessive heat, further enhancing their capability to flourish in challenging climates.

Windbreaks and barriers can play a pivotal role in modifying your garden’s microclimate. Areas exposed to harsh winds pose a threat to delicate plants and can lead to moisture loss. Consider planting hardy shrubs, trees, or erecting fences to create a buffer against strong gusts. Trees with dense foliage, such as pines or spruces, can serve as effective screens, slowing wind speeds and reducing water evaporation. Position windbreaks strategically on the north or northwest edges to protect your more sensitive plants from prevailing winds, safeguarding against desiccation and frost damage.

Another essential aspect to consider is plant selection. Choosing the right varieties that are well-suited to your microclimate can greatly influence your garden’s overall health. For example, if you live in an area that experiences extreme heat, consider heat-tolerant varieties like Bell Peppers and Eggplants—both are known to thrive under high temperatures and stress. Additionally, certain plants like Lavender and Thyme not only survive but flourish in arid conditions, making them excellent choices for drier microclimates. Conversely, for regions that are prone to cooler temperatures, select frost-resistant plants such as Brussels Sprouts and Kale, which can withstand chillier conditions while still providing a fruitful harvest.

Furthermore, the practice of companion planting can significantly enhance your garden’s overall microclimate. This method involves planting compatible species in proximity to achieve mutual benefits, such as pest control, pollination enhancement, and soil improvement. For instance, interspersing Basil with Tomatoes not only may improve flavor profiles but also aids in repelling pests like hornworms. Additionally, plants such as Nasturtiums can act as trap crops, drawing aphids away from your more delicate species. Such strategic placements can create a diverse environment that is better equipped to withstand environmental pressures.

Moreover, incorporating other structures, such as hoop houses or cold frames, can significantly extend the growing season for your plants while providing protection from extreme temperatures and unexpected weather changes. These structures can trap warmth and regulate humidity levels, creating a stable microclimate that nurtures seedling growth during colder months. For those in harsher climates, a small hoop house can transform your gardening schedule, allowing you to start planting earlier in spring and extend harvesting later into fall.

Natural elements such as rocks, boulders, and even artificial ponds can further enhance the heat retention and moisture levels of your garden. Strategically placing larger stones or boulders around the borders or within garden beds can absorb heat from the sun during the day and release it slowly at night, helping to regulate temperature for your plants. Similarly, ponds can foster a unique humid zone, particularly beneficial for plants that appreciate more moisture, creating a diverse and thriving environment.
